Dataminnet
Dataminnet is a distributed, open platform designed to enable collaborative data mining and analytics across organizational boundaries. It provides a framework for sharing, discovering, and processing large datasets while preserving data ownership, licensing terms, and automated lineage tracking. The goal is to lower barriers to data-driven research and enterprise analytics by coordinating resources on a network of participating nodes.
